Wednesday, March 25, marked the anniversary of a critical Denver Nuggets trade. Five years ago, Aaron Gordon landed on the team from the Orlando Magic, teaming up with Nikola Jokic.
In hindsight, the trade turned out to be a massive win for Denver. Gordon not only thrived with the Nuggets back then, but he also continues to be a critical member of the roster so many years later.
Nuggets superstar Nikola Jokic was reminded of the deal on Wednesday, following a victory over the Dallas Mavericks. When he recalled the moment he found out, Jokic revealed that it was an emotional time for him.
“I remember saying goodbye to Gary Harris, and I cried because I was so sad because we had a little bit of a good connection, and we played really good,” Jokic told reporters.

“So, it was a little bit of a sad moment for me. It was actually, I think it was the plane, we landed, and then something like that happened. I’m happy that we have AG. Of course, he’s a unique player. Special player for us.”
The Nuggets Cut Ties With Gary Harris

Harris, now 31, started his career with the Nuggets. When he entered the NBA out of Michigan State, he was a first-round, 19th overall pick, in 2014.
The Chicago Bulls selected Harris, but traded him to the Nuggets on the night of the draft. Harris stuck with the Nuggets for seven seasons. He carved out a successful run as a role player, averaging 12.0 points, 2.6 rebounds, and 2.1 assists in Denver.
When Harris went to the Magic, he spent five seasons in Orlando. He started 121 of the 231 games he played. After appearing in 48 games with the Magic last season, his team option was declined ahead of the 2025 free agency period.
Harris signed a two-year deal with the Milwaukee Bucks last July. He continues his 12-year career in the Eastern Conference this season.
In the deal, the Nuggets also parted ways with RJ Hampton and a future pick. Clearly, Harris’ departure is what stuck with Jokic.
It All Worked Out For Denver

Emotions might’ve been high, but the impact couldn’t be denied.
Aaron Gordon is in the midst of a six-year run with the Nuggets, and he’s been a fantastic complementary player on the team.
In 323 games, Gordon has averaged 14.8 points, 5.9 rebounds, and 2.9 assists. He’s been making 50.1% of his field goals and hitting on 41.0% of his threes.
Gordon was a key player in the Nuggets’ 2022-2023 NBA Championship run. He hopes to be a part of another, as the Nuggets remain one of the Western Conference’s top teams in 2025-2026.
